Transaction 88403939e420f4bfb84a3bc8469b60a1ec7582628db8a65abe5b281b33a93d94
1 Input
1 Output
-
88403939e420f4bfb84a3bc8469b60a1ec7582628db8a65abe5b281b33a93d94:0
- value
- 495463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46f8bbc8904f962f078e2c67984ed1ad23934f0d OP_EQUAL
- address
- 38AHCHDjjKmLL4FmgnrKfdbJDsP4DAkMKE